Ahmedabad: A local court on Thursday remanded Mayur Mali, a co-accused in the Rs 1.66 crore jewellery theft case, to police custody till May 25 after his arrest by Nikol police.Mali is accused of conspiring to steal from a city jewellery showroom with the help of his associate Harshida Shetty, who worked there as a sales staffer.
On May 11, she allegedly fled with 1.211kg of gold jewellery worth Rs 1.66 crore.Following her arrest, Shetty allegedly disclosed that the theft was planned with Mali’s assistance, and that they travelled on his bike to Udaipur, Jaipur and Delhi. She claimed that Mali took away a major share of the stolen jewellery.Seeking five-day custody, the investigating officer told the court that jewellery worth Rs 16.7 lakh had been recovered from Mali and his custodial interrogation was needed to trace the remaining stolen items, as nearly 800 grams of jewellery is yet to be recovered.Citing Mali’s lack of cooperation, the officer stated in the remand report that he was not disclosing where he had sold some of the items. Shetty had revealed that Mali sold a bracelet at a GIFT City shop and another item in Delhi, but he has not revealed the buyers’ identities.Police also informed the court that a cheating complaint is registered against Mali at Madhavpura police station, and his interrogation is necessary to ascertain involvement in other offences.
